加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.021zz.com.cn/)- 应用安全、建站、数据安全、媒体智能、运维!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ix下视觉开发:极速包管理与环境搭建

发布时间:2026-04-11 11:43:17 所属栏目:Unix 来源:DaWei
导读:  在Unix系统上进行视觉开发,从一开始就面临环境配置的挑战。然而,借助现代化的包管理工具,这一过程正变得前所未有的高效。以macOS为例,Homebrew作为最流行的包管理器,能够一键安装图形库、编译工具链和开发依

  在Unix系统上进行视觉开发,从一开始就面临环境配置的挑战。然而,借助现代化的包管理工具,这一过程正变得前所未有的高效。以macOS为例,Homebrew作为最流行的包管理器,能够一键安装图形库、编译工具链和开发依赖,极大缩短了前期准备时间。


  Visual Studio Code(VS Code)是当前主流的跨平台代码编辑器,其在Unix环境下表现尤为出色。通过官方渠道安装后,配合插件市场中的Python、C++、Live Server等扩展,开发者可迅速搭建起支持实时预览与智能提示的视觉开发环境。所有组件均通过包管理器或图形界面完成,无需手动下载或配置路径。


  对于需要高性能图形处理的项目,如图像渲染或动画开发,Vulkan、OpenGL等底层图形接口的集成也已实现自动化。使用Homebrew或MacPorts,只需一条命令即可安装对应开发库,并自动链接到系统环境变量中。这避免了传统方式下因版本冲突或路径错误导致的“编译失败”问题。


  容器化技术如Docker进一步简化了环境一致性难题。通过编写一个简单的Dockerfile,可以将整个视觉开发栈——包括Node.js、Python、FFmpeg、ImageMagick等——封装在一个隔离环境中。无论团队成员使用何种操作系统,只要运行docker-compose up,就能获得完全一致的开发体验。


  Unix系统的脚本能力为自动化提供了天然优势。结合bash或zsh脚本,可以创建一键初始化脚本,自动执行包安装、环境变量设置、服务启动等操作。例如,一条命令即可完成从零开始的React+Three.js项目搭建,包含本地服务器与热重载功能。


  值得一提的是,现代开源生态已形成高度协同的开发范式。许多知名视觉框架如P5.js、Three.js、PixiJS等,均提供npm包支持,可通过npm install快速引入。配合package.json管理依赖关系,版本控制与更新维护变得清晰可控。


2026AI设计稿,仅供参考

  总体而言,如今在Unix系统上开展视觉开发,已不再是繁琐的配置之旅。借助成熟的包管理、标准化的构建工具与开放的生态系统,开发者能将精力聚焦于创意本身,而非环境搭建的琐碎细节。高效、稳定、可复用的开发流程,正是现代视觉工程的核心优势。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章